Medications
In many cases, medication can help in reducing depression symptoms. Nevertheless, the type of medication you need depends upon your individual symptoms and how serious they are. Your psychiatrist will suggest the right medication for your scenario. You might also require to take other medications along with antidepressants to enhance the results of them. This is called augmentation. Examples of augmentation medicines consist of aripiprazole (Abilify), quetiapine (Seroquel) and lithium (Lithobid).
Lots of people find that the very first antidepressant they try doesn't work, or triggers undesirable negative effects that make them not want to continue taking it. Do not quit; the majority of people take four to six weeks for the first antidepressant they try to reach their full effect. Your doctor can alter the dose or timing of your medication to assist ease adverse effects. They can likewise change you to another antidepressant if your previous one does not work.
Ser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RIs) are the most typically recommended antidepressants, but there are others as well. These consist of selective serotonin and norepinephrine reuptake inhibitors (SNRIs) and bupropion (Wellbutrin XL). Periodically your doctor might likewise suggest a tricyclic antidepressant, or a monoamine oxidase inhibitor. MAOIs are older medications that block an enzyme and boost levels of brain chemicals connected to state of mind, such as serotonin and norepinephrine. They are seldom used now, however can be recommended if other treatments do not assist. Examples of MAOIs consist of phenelzine (Nardil), tranylcypromine (Parnate) and isocarboxazid (Marplan).
If you've been depressed in the past, you're at increased risk for reoccurrence. Medication can help avoid or deal with reoccurrence, but you need continuous treatment to stay healthy.

Psychiatric therapy
Psychiatric therapy, or talk therapy, is a major part of treatment for depression. It involves one-on-one sessions with a psychologist, social employee or counsellor. It may also be part of a group setting that consists of people with similar issues. These groups can be really practical and provide a sense of neighborhood. Some people find that they can cope with depression better in a supportive group than by themselves. Psychiatric therapy can help in reducing symptoms of depression, such as suicidal ideas and sensations of despondence. It can likewise increase motivation and improve coping skills. It can also teach you to acknowledge and manage unfavorable feelings, such as anger or guilt. Many individuals take advantage of psychiatric therapy alone, however it can be specifically reliable when utilized in mix with other treatments.
The specifics of psychotherapy vary, however it normally focuses on discussing your sensations and issues. During these sessions, the therapist will attempt to comprehend your situation and explain the causes of your problems. It can likewise assist to explore your past experiences and how they may have contributed to your condition. You may need several sessions to see a significant enhancement.
If you have an extreme case of depression, a adult adhd psychiatrist near me may advise psychiatric therapy in addition to medication. Some kinds of psychotherapy are more effective than others, however all are intended to deal with the signs of depression. They can consist of cognitive behavioral treatment, which assists you recognize and change distorted or negative attitude patterns; analytical treatment, which teaches you to fix everyday obstacles; and behavioural activation, which motivates favorable behaviors.

Support groups
Depression support system are a terrific method to get in touch with others in similar circumstances. They can be discovered online or personally, and they are typically facilitated by psychological health professionals who function as co-facilitators. The primary advantages of depression support groups are ongoing social contact, opportunities to share struggles and work through services, and guidance from mental health specialists. These groups are often free, however might charge a small charge for one-on-one therapy sessions with a psychological evaluation near me (use this link) health specialist.
The Depression and Bipolar Support Alliance (DBSA) includes a variety of resources and aid, consisting of more than 600 peer-led support groups. These groups are offered in both in-person and virtual settings, and include specialized mates for military veterans, young grownups, BIPOC neighborhoods, caretakers, and people who have co-occurring drug abuse. There are also a variety of online nationwide assistance groups hosted on Support Groups Central. These are used on numerous weekdays and times, so discovering the best fit is easy.
